Interpreting Dreams About Whales

Dreams about whales can manifest in various forms, each carrying its own symbolism and interpretation. When interpreting these dreams, it's essential to consider the context, emotions, and personal experiences of the dreamer. Here are some common scenarios involving whales in dreams and their possible meanings:

Whales Swimming Peacefully:

Dreaming of whales gliding gracefully through calm waters may symbolize serenity, inner peace, and emotional balance. It could reflect a sense of harmony and contentment in the dreamer's life, or a longing for tranquility amidst turbulent times.


Whales in Turbulent Waters:

Conversely, dreams of whales navigating stormy seas or turbulent waters may indicate emotional upheaval, challenges, or uncertainty in the dreamer's waking life. The presence of the whale amidst the chaos could symbolize resilience, inner strength, and the ability to navigate through adversity.


Interactions with Whales:

Dreams featuring interactions with whales, such as observing them from afar, swimming alongside them, or being chased by them, offer deeper insights into the dreamer's psyche. Observing whales may represent introspection and self-reflection, while swimming with them could symbolize a desire for connection, intimacy, or spiritual guidance. Being chased by whales may suggest unresolved fears, anxieties, or subconscious issues that need addressing.

Exploring Common Dream Variations Involving Whales

Beyond these general interpretations, dreams about whales can take on various forms and scenarios, each with its own nuances and symbolism. Here are some common variations of dreams about whales:

Dreams of Specific Whale Species:

Dreaming of specific whale species, such as blue whales or humpback whales, can offer additional insights into the dream's meaning. For example, blue whales, known for their immense size and gentle nature, may symbolize the need for emotional nourishment and self-care. Humpback whales, famous for their majestic songs and acrobatic displays, could represent creativity, expression, and communication.


Dreams About Whale Behaviors:

Dreams depicting specific behaviors of whales, such as breaching, diving, or singing, may carry distinct symbolism. Breaching whales, leaping out of the water in a display of strength and vitality, could symbolize breakthroughs, triumphs, or moments of personal growth. Whales singing melodious tunes underwater may symbolize the need for self-expression, creativity, or finding one's voice.


Dreams Featuring Other Marine Creatures:

Dreams that include other marine creatures alongside whales, such as dolphins or sharks, add layers of complexity to the dream's interpretation. Dolphins, often associated with playfulness, intelligence, and social bonds, may symbolize companionship, joy, or emotional connection. Conversely, sharks, symbolizing danger, aggression, or hidden threats, may represent fears, challenges, or unresolved conflicts in the dreamer's life.
